Adani Emerges as Top Bidder for NH Stretch in Tamil Nadu.

Adani Road Transport has emerged as the top bidder for managing a 124-km stretch of national highway in Tamil Nadu under the toll-operate-transfer (TOT) model, with an offer of ₹1,692 crore.

The bid was followed by IRB Infrastructure Developers at ₹1,485 crore, Epic Concessions at ₹1,152 crore, and Prakash Asphaltings & Toll Highways at ₹876 crore. The stretch in question is the four-lane Trichy-Thuvarankurichi-Madurai section of NH-38.

The National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) opened the financial bids on Tuesday, and the contract is expected to be awarded to the highest bidder after board approval, according to a senior government official.

The NHAI had auctioned TOT Bundle 15 in mid-2024 as part of its ongoing efforts to boost highway infrastructure across the country.
